The Melbourne Airport Rail Link project has appointed an independent chair as community consultation opens for the Sunshine Superhub.

The Melbourne Airport Rail Link (MARL) project has taken an important step forward, with the appointment of Ms Merren McArthur as the independent Chair of the MARL Steering Committee.

This development comes as planning consultation is now underway for the Sunshine Superhub, representing a major milestone for the transformative rail project, which will connect Melbourne Airport to Victoria’s metropolitan and regional rail networks.

The $4 billion Sunshine Superhub, a joint investment by the Australian and Victorian governments, will involve works spanning more than 6km from West Footscray to Albion and represents the first crucial stage of the Melbourne Airport Rail Link project.

Community consultation

Community members now have the opportunity to provide input on the planning matters for the Sunshine Superhub project as part of the formal planning approval process.

The consultation covers a range of issues including project boundaries, environmental management, heritage impacts, tree and vegetation removal, amenity considerations, traffic and access arrangements, and construction-related impacts.

The new superhub will untangle Melbourne’s most complex rail junction outside the CBD, adding two new platforms that will unlock extra capacity for additional services for the growing communities of Melton and Wyndham Vale, and to the airport.

When complete, the project will enable more than 40 train services per hour through Sunshine Station, dramatically improving connectivity for Melbourne’s rapidly growing western suburbs.

The Sunshine Superhub project represents essential infrastructure development that will enable the future airport rail connection while also supporting electrification of the Melton line.

Delivering upgrades at Sunshine Station now will drastically reduce future disruptions for both the Melbourne Airport Rail and Melton Line electrification projects that will follow.

The Victorian government has described the project as transformational for Melbourne’s west, positioning Sunshine as a gateway to regional Victoria and creating significant economic opportunities for the area.

The Sunshine Superhub will serve as the crucial first step in establishing the full Melbourne Airport Rail Link, which will provide the city’s first direct rail connection to its major international gateway.

Construction of the enabling works package will commence in early 2026, focusing initially on utility diversions and infrastructure preparation.

The complex project has been divided into five distinct work packages to manage the scale and complexity of the transformation across the six-kilometre corridor.

New Albion Station

As part of work to deliver the Sunshine Superhub, a new Albion Station will be built to become a modern and accessible station.

The new station will deliver upgraded passenger facilities and improved connections to more services and the Metro Tunnel.

The new station will also enable easier access to a future airport rail line, just one stop away from the Sunshine Superhub.

Detailed planning and design work is now underway, with concept designs to be released at a later date and commencement of separate planning consultation for Albion Station in 2026.

Further design development and community engagement will be undertaken to shape the details of the new station.
